Sharonville vs Maumee
Side-by-side comparison
How does Sharonville, OH compare to Maumee, OH? Sharonville has a population of 13,989 with a median household income of $70,781, while Maumee has 13,765 residents and a median income of $81,739.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Sharonville, OH | Maumee, OH |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 13,989 | 13,765 | +1.6% |
| Median Age | 44.5 | 39.2 | +13.5% |
| Foreign Born % | 10.1% | 1.8% | +461.1% |
| Metric | Sharonville | Maumee |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$70,781 | $81,739 | -13.4% |
| Unemployment | 1.6% | 2.5% | -36.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 5.7% | 6.2% | -8.1% |
| Bachelor's+ | 36.1% | 37.2% | -3.0% |
| Metric | Sharonville | Maumee |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$207,900 | $185,600 | +12.0% |
| Median Rent | $1129/mo | $939/mo | +20.2% |
| Housing Units | 7,409 | 6,213 | +19.2% |
